WebHere is a basic HIIT Treadmill workout that will help get you started: 1. Basic warm-up starting with a brisk walk and work your way up to a light jog – 10 minutes 2. Run at 10 mph for 30 seconds to 1 minute 3. Walk at 3.5-4 mph for 2 minutes 4. Repeat this cycle 7 more times (8 cycles total) 5. WebHigh-intensity interval training ( HIIT) is a training protocol alternating short periods of intense or explosive anaerobic exercise with brief recovery periods until the point of exhaustion. [1] HIIT involves exercises performed in repeated quick bursts at maximum or near maximal effort with periods of rest or low activity between bouts.
